Postdoctoral Fellow in Metal-organic Frameworks for CO2 removal, WISE

This recruitment is connected to the Wallenberg Initiative Materials Science for Sustainability (WISE, wise-materials.org). WISE, funded by the Knut and Alice Wallenberg Foundation, is the largest-ever investment in materials science in Sweden and will encompass major efforts at Sweden’s foremost universities over the course of 10 years. The vision is a sustainable future through materials science. Read more: https://wise-materials.org

The project aims to explore new approaches on design and synthesis of metal-organic frameworks (MOFs) for removal of CO2. The novel materials are expected to be used as sorbents for CO2 capture and catalysts for CO2 reduction reactions. Electron diffraction will be used to study the crystal structures and properties of the MOFs.

PhD student in Materials Chemistry (MSCA COFUND project PRISMAS)

We are looking for a new PhD student to take on a project focused on fundamental research devoted to elucidate aggregation of lignin from solution in the presence of metal ions.

You will be part of PRISMAS - PhD Research and Innovation in Synchrotron Methods and Applications in Sweden. As a PRISMAS PhD student, you will have the chance to conduct cutting-edge research in your field, taking advantage of state of the art tools that will bring to attractive future job opportunities in academia or industry.

Postdoctoral Fellow in Metal-Organic Frameworks for Water Treatment

We are looking for a post doc fellow connected to the Wallenberg Initiative Materials Science for Sustainability (WISE)

The aim of this project is to develop metal-organic frameworks (MOFs) made using plant-based organic linkers for the removal of aqueous pollutants such as active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s).
